American Food American food is perhaps not the world’s most-celebrated cuisine, but it is varied, it is influential, and it is even a bit surprising. Just as with most of the world’s cooking styles, what is eaten at home and what is eaten in restaurants can often be quite different. Homes often stress quick and easy, while restaurants can push the limits of what is possible. People often go to restaurants to eat food they find too time-consuming and difficult to fix at home.

Fast Food The most well-known type of American food is “fast food”. Fast food is called “fast food” because it is meant to be made fast and eaten fast. When a normal office worker gets only about 30 minutes for lunch, he needs to be able to get in and out of a restaurant at top speed. Fast food restaurants have come up with methods of preparing large amounts of food in very little time, so fast food can include items not usually considered easy to make. The most common fast-food option is the sandwich, in its most basic form a combination of meat and bread. A fast-food meal usually consists of a sandwich, french fries (or potato chips), and some sort of beverage. In an effort to cater to a more health-conscious clientele wary of fast food’s poor reputation, most chains have updated their menus with healthier options (like salads). Be aware, however, that although fast food is very popular, it is not the only American food, and a large number of Americans eat it only sparingly.

Among fast-food sandwiches, the hamburger is king. A hamburger is composed of two pieces of bread (the bun), the top piece being larger and rounder than the bottom one. In between is placed a flat, round piece of ground beef (the patty). To improve the flavor of the hamburger many people apply various condiments, such as ketchup, mustard, and mayonnaise. Other additions include pickles, tomatoes, onions, and lettuce. Some people even apply a slice of cheese, creating a “cheeseburger”. Restaurants that have made their names primarily on hamburgers include: McDonald’s, Burger King, Jack in the Box, Hardee’s, and Carl’s Jr. Wendy’s, another popular hamburger restaurant, is famous for its square patties. White Castle, a less common restaurant, is famous for its mini-hamburgers (known as “sliders”).

Submarine sandwiches (a. k. a. subs, a. k. a. hoagies), sandwiches made with long, submarine-shaped (or torpedo-shaped) buns, can be bought at restaurants such as Subway and Blimpie. The long buns can be filled will all sorts of meats and vegetables. Quiznos is a sandwich shop famous for toasting its subs. Other more-traditional sandwich options are served at restaurants such as McAlister’s Deli and Schlotzsky’s. Another sandwich restaurant is Arby’s, which is famous for its roast beef sandwiches.

Fried chicken is another popular food found at fast-food restaurants. Although even hamburger restaurants will often offer a chicken sandwich for variety, there are other eating establishments almost solely devoted to chicken options. Kentucky Fried Chicken (KFC) is the best known of the chicken places. Similar, but less popular, chicken restaurants are Bojangles’ and Popeyes Chicken and Biscuits. Chick-fil-A, based in the southeast, does not serve fried chicken at all, but its entire menu is stocked with other chicken choices like chicken sandwiches, chicken strips, and chicken nuggets.

Pizza probably came to America with immigrants from southern Italy. It was America, however, that brought pizza to the world. Take some bread dough, spread it out into a circle, add some tomato sauce and mozzarella cheese, and you have the most basic pizza. Change the crust (the bread) a bit, or change the sauce, or change the cheese and other toppings and you can create a million variations of this very simple food. Pizza Hut, Papa John’s, Pizza Inn, Little Caesars, and Domino’s Pizza are the most common pizza restaurants in the United States.

Even seafood has made it into the fast-food business. Fish, shrimp, and even clams can be found at Captain D’s and Long John Silver’s, the two most popular fast-food seafood eateries. Grilled versions of the entrees can be ordered for the more health-conscious consumer. A common seafood side item is the hushpuppy, a fried cornmeal concoction.
